Indian football head coach Igor Stimac hailed Sunil Chhetri, saying the talismanic captain was one of those who "glorified" Indian football with his dedication in the 15 years of his illustrious career. The 35-year-old Chhetri on Friday became only the second Indian after legendary Bhaichung Bhutia to complete 15 years in Indian jersey.
